Door lock guard
Description
FIG. 1 is a front and side perspective view of a door lock guard showing my new design in the closed position, the broken line showing of a padlock are for illustrative purposes only;
FIG. 2 is a bottom plan view thereof, in the open position and the broken lines showing a door knob are for illustrative purposes only;
FIG. 3 is a front elevational view thereof;
FIG. 4 is a side elevational view thereof, the opposite side being substantially identical.
